The hexadecimal color code #BB49BB corresponds to the code RGB( 187, 73, 187 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,73 level), green (at 0,29 level) and blue (at 0,73 level). Its brightness is 50% and its saturation is 45%. It is composed of red at 41%, green at 16% and blue at 41%.
